The traffic ticket penalties vary in different states and for different factors, such as age. Consequences for a Florida traffic ticket can include a suspended or revoked driver’s license and an increase in auto insurance. There are additional penalties for drivers under 21 and specific types of licenses, such as CDL licenses. Our traffic ticket defense attorneys are committed to getting the least severe consequences possible for all of their clients. For example, a lawyer may not be able to get your fine lowered, but he may be able to negotiate a lower number of points on your driving record.

What You Can Expect During Your First Meeting

Be ready to share your side of the story during your first appointment with a traffic ticket attorney. Many people find it beneficial to write notes ahead of time so they don’t skip any details during the meeting. Be forthcoming and candid throughout this discussion, sharing as much as you can about your case. In turn, the attorney will share his knowledge of the laws that are applicable to your case and explain how he will use them to protect your rights and fight for a favorable outcome.
